Rip-off! Bait and switch when it was time to seal the deal

I got a call from David Allen, representing a supposed Mastercard company, at my place of employment. He referred to a Mastercard I had recently applied for. I thought for a moment and in fact had applied for a Mastercard. Although the name of the company he represented, Continental Services, didn't ring a bell with me as the company I had applied with, I heard the guy out.

He was offering a "regular" Mastercard with an initial $2500 limit, no annual fees, no monthly fees, and 0.0% interest rate that could be used for purchases and for cash internationally! They threw in a 3 day 2 night stay at the vacation location of my choice, all expenses paid! All that was required was a one time fee of $329.80 which must be paid in advance. He assured me that this would rebuild my credit in no time.

When it came time to verify and record all of my information with his supervisor, he asked me to answer only the question asked. He reviewed the deal, but left out the part about the credit card.

When it came to the question "Did my representative promise you anything beside what we have just discussed?" and I said "Yes, he promised me a Mastercard credit card with an initial credit limit of $2500". I then heard a loud "click".

I asked "What was that noise". He replied "What noise?" I said "That click I just heard, what was that?" to which he replied "Oh, I just took you off of the recorder". When I asked why he told me because we weren't discussing the terms of the deal, to which I replied "I think it's because you didn't like my last answer."

I thanked him for all the information I had requested on the company and told him it would come in very handy when I reported them to the Better Business Bureau the the Attorney General's office. They hung up.

I had to close my checking account and reopen under a new account number. I smelled a rat from the beginning! Lesson learned - If it walks like a duck, quacks like a duck, and waddles like a duck, chances are it IS a duck. And if it sounds too good to be true, it probably is.
